SALISBURY Saintes Twinning Association is to hold its annual meeting tomorrow.
The meeting will be in the St John Suite of the city’s White Hart Hotel at 7.30pm.
As well as a report on a busy year, which has seen much joint activity between members of both communities, there will be announcements of events to come.
Following the business part of the meeting, Amy Whetstone, a former South Wilts School pupil now in her final year at Oxford University, will speak about her time working at a school in Saintes last year.
All are welcome to attend. More information is available at salisburysaintestwinning.co.uk.
